Country music star Kane Brown has announced a temporary departure from social media following intense criticism he received after posting tributes related to recent tragic events. The controversy erupted when Brown shared a tribute to conservative activist Charlie Kirk, who was fatally shot during a speaking event at a Utah university on September 10, 2025.
The Dual Tributes and Resulting Backlash
Brown’s social media activity included not only a tribute to Kirk but also acknowledgment of a high school mass shooting in Colorado that occurred on the same day. This attempt at showing empathy for multiple tragedies backfired as fans from across the political spectrum attacked the singer for various perceived failings.
The criticism came from multiple directions. Some presumably left-leaning fans criticized Brown for not posting about the June 2025 murders of Minnesota House Speaker Melissa Hortman and her husband Mark Hortman, who were fatally shot in their home. Meanwhile, others from the conservative side accused him of “bowing down to liberals” by acknowledging the school shooting alongside his Kirk tribute.
Personal Attacks and Brown’s Response
Perhaps most troubling was a comment suggesting that Brown, who is biracial, had “offended his ancestors” by paying tribute to Kirk, whom the commenter described as “a racist bigot who didn’t believe in gun regulations.” Brown responded directly to this accusation with a powerful statement: “I’ve been called a n—-r my whole life. I don’t want those people dead.”
This exchange appears to have been the final straw for Brown, who concluded his response by stating, “My last post for a while, be safe guys and love one another.” The statement indicates his decision to step back from social media following the heated exchanges.
